当前位置: 首页 > news >正文

网站建设的成本网络营销百科

网站建设的成本,网络营销百科,福州百度网站快速优化,线上推广渠道和方式文章目录 Kettle 安装配置Kettle 安装Kettle 配置连接 Hive Kettle 安装配置 Kettle 安装 在安装Kettle之前,需要确定已经安装Java运行环境。Kettle需要Java的支持才能运行,JDK的版本最好是8.x的太新的也会出现bug。Kettle的7.1版本的太旧了&#xff0…

文章目录

  • Kettle 安装配置
    • Kettle 安装
    • Kettle 配置
    • 连接 Hive

Kettle 安装配置

Kettle 安装

在安装Kettle之前,需要确定已经安装Java运行环境。Kettle需要Java的支持才能运行,JDK的版本最好是8.x的太新的也会出现bug。Kettle的7.1版本的太旧了,容易出现闪退,右击就死机等bug,9.x太新了也会有bug,下载8.2版本的安装包。如图所示:Kettle官方网站下载地址如下:Pentaho from Hitachi Vantara - Browse Files at SourceForge.net

在这里插入图片描述

在Windows系统上,可以直接双击“spoon.bat”文件启动Kettle。在Linux或Mac OS系统上,可以在命令行中输入“./spoon.sh”命令启动Kettle。

在这里插入图片描述

Kettle 配置

完成了Kettle的安装之后,我们还需要通过配置,使得Kettle可以与Hadoop 协同工作。通过提交适当的参数,Kettl可以连接Hadoop的HDFS、MapReduce、Zookeeper、Oozie、Sqoop 和Spark服务。在数据库连接类型中支持Hive和Impala。

在配置连接前,要确认Hadoop和Hive虚拟机中已经正确安装并启动。使用FTP工具,连接虚拟机,找到Hadoop和Hive中的配置文件:core-site.xml、hdfs-site.xml、yarn-site.xml、mapred-site.xml、hive-site.xml,合计5个,下载到Kettle根目录下的plugins\pentaho-big-data-plugin\hadoop-configurations\cdh514目录下,覆盖原来Kettle自带的这些文件。

​在本机配置IP地址映射,修改C:\Windows\System32\drivers\etc\hosts文件,加入主机名与IP对应关系,填自己的IP和主机名。

192.168.88.102 hadoop102
192.168.88.103 hadoop103
192.168.88.104 hadoop104

在Spoon界面中,选择主菜单“工具”→“Hadoop Distribution…”,从弹出窗口中可以看到五种Shim。选择“Cloudera CDH 514”,点击OK 按钮确定后重启Spoon.


​接下来我们新建一个作业来测试一下Kettle与Hadoop的连接。在工作区左侧的树的“主对象树”标签中,右击“作业”点击“新建”。选择 Hadoop clusters→ 右键 New Cluster。

在这里插入图片描述
选择对话框中输入如图所示的属性值

在这里插入图片描述

​ Hadoop集群配置窗口中的选项及定义说明如下:

  • Cluster Name:定义要连接的集群名称,这里为hadoop。
  • Hostname(HDFS 段):Hadoop集群中NameNode节点的主机名。本例中在虚拟机的主机名已经设置为hadoop102。
  • Port(HDFS 段):Hadoop集群中NameNode节点的端口号。
  • Username(HDFS 段):HDFS的用户名,通过宿主操作系统给出,可以不填。这里为虚拟机登录用户名。
  • Password(HDFS 段):HDFS的密码,通过宿主操作系统给出,可以不填。虚拟机登录密码。
  • Hostname(JobTracker 段):Hadoop集群中JobTracker节点的主机名。如果有独立的JobTracker节点,在此输入,否则使用HDFS的主机名。
  • Port(JobTracker 段):Hadoop集群中JobTracker节点的端口号,不能与 HDFS 的端口号相同。
  • Hostname(ZooKeeper 段):Hadoop集群中Zookeeper节点的主机名,只有在连接Zookeeper 服务时才需要。
  • Port(ZooKeeper 段):Hadoop集群中Zookeeper节点的端口号,只有在连接Zookeepe服务时才需要。
  • URL(Oozie 段):Oozie WebUI的地址,只有在连接Oozie。

然后点击“测试”按钮,测试结果如图2-6所示。此时Oozi和Zookeeper 因为没有进行安装,所以必定会有连接失败的警告。“User Home Directory Access”这条报错则是由于当前 Kettle 是安装在宿主机的Windows系统中,Windows 上

运行的 Kettle 在连接 Hadoop 集群时,始终用本机用户连接 Hadoop 集群,因此User Home Directory Access会报错。将Kettle 安装到 Hadoop 所在的虚拟机中可以解决此问题。此处不影响后续的操作。

在这里插入图片描述

连接 Hive

接下来,我们再尝试使用Kettle连接Hive。Kettle把Hive当作一个数据库,支持连接Hive Server和Hive Server 2,数据库连接类型的名字分别为Hadoop Hive 和 Hadoop Hive 2。这里在Kettle中建立一个Hadoop Hive 2类型的数据库连接。

在远程连接虚拟机,进入 Hive 目录,然后启动 HiveServer2 服务,命令“hiveserver2”,


在Kettle工作区左侧的“主对象树”标签中,选择“DB 连接” → 右键“新建”,对话框中输入如图所示的属性值

在这里插入图片描述
上图的数据库连接配置窗口中的选项及定义说明如下:

  • Connection Name:定义连接名称,这里为 hive。
  • Connection Type:连接类型选择 Hadoop Hive 2。
  • Host Name:输入HiveServer2对应的主机名,这里是hadoop102。
  • Datebase Name:这里输入的default是Hive里默认的一个数据库名称。
  • Port Number:端口号输入hive.server2.thrift.port参数的值,我们连接时设置的端口号为10000。
  • User Name:用户名,这里为虚拟机登录用户名。
  • Password:密码,这里为虚拟机登录密码。

点击“测试”,应该弹出成功连接窗口

为了让其它转换或作业能够使用此数据库连接对象,需要将它设置为共享。选择 “DB连接”→ hive → 右键“共享”,然后保存作业。


文章转载自:
http://dinncobenempt.bkqw.cn
http://dinncophrynin.bkqw.cn
http://dinncounlink.bkqw.cn
http://dinncoroadworthy.bkqw.cn
http://dinncogallivorous.bkqw.cn
http://dinncocris.bkqw.cn
http://dinncoundelegated.bkqw.cn
http://dinncoapron.bkqw.cn
http://dinncoihram.bkqw.cn
http://dinncolimulus.bkqw.cn
http://dinncometatarsus.bkqw.cn
http://dinncoaeriferous.bkqw.cn
http://dinncorubefaction.bkqw.cn
http://dinncoreinsure.bkqw.cn
http://dinncofetoprotein.bkqw.cn
http://dinncohypoparathyroidism.bkqw.cn
http://dinncoocarina.bkqw.cn
http://dinncolimbers.bkqw.cn
http://dinncorieka.bkqw.cn
http://dinncoglacier.bkqw.cn
http://dinncohabdabs.bkqw.cn
http://dinncospiggoty.bkqw.cn
http://dinncocerci.bkqw.cn
http://dinncomarquis.bkqw.cn
http://dinncoswimmable.bkqw.cn
http://dinncoalkoran.bkqw.cn
http://dinncobeamed.bkqw.cn
http://dinncourd.bkqw.cn
http://dinncoproglottid.bkqw.cn
http://dinncoplosive.bkqw.cn
http://dinncomicawberish.bkqw.cn
http://dinncolube.bkqw.cn
http://dinncopippy.bkqw.cn
http://dinncohostage.bkqw.cn
http://dinncoaseity.bkqw.cn
http://dinncobobotie.bkqw.cn
http://dinncosubdepot.bkqw.cn
http://dinncoinquest.bkqw.cn
http://dinncomacchinetta.bkqw.cn
http://dinncolevis.bkqw.cn
http://dinncogasman.bkqw.cn
http://dinncoslabby.bkqw.cn
http://dinncoforeship.bkqw.cn
http://dinncoprevalency.bkqw.cn
http://dinncoimmortalise.bkqw.cn
http://dinncosexploitation.bkqw.cn
http://dinncotestaceous.bkqw.cn
http://dinncohonan.bkqw.cn
http://dinncocapriciously.bkqw.cn
http://dinncoorology.bkqw.cn
http://dinncodimly.bkqw.cn
http://dinncosemon.bkqw.cn
http://dinncoinattentively.bkqw.cn
http://dinncopteridosperm.bkqw.cn
http://dinncoexegetically.bkqw.cn
http://dinncocoven.bkqw.cn
http://dinncolavrock.bkqw.cn
http://dinncopontoon.bkqw.cn
http://dinncodraught.bkqw.cn
http://dinncopatroon.bkqw.cn
http://dinncorearrangement.bkqw.cn
http://dinncobrassiness.bkqw.cn
http://dinncorhomb.bkqw.cn
http://dinncowoodland.bkqw.cn
http://dinncocapsizal.bkqw.cn
http://dinncorumina.bkqw.cn
http://dinncoblackthorn.bkqw.cn
http://dinncosungari.bkqw.cn
http://dinncobinuclear.bkqw.cn
http://dinncoforetype.bkqw.cn
http://dinncocinerous.bkqw.cn
http://dinncomedicament.bkqw.cn
http://dinnconarcose.bkqw.cn
http://dinncodiatomaceous.bkqw.cn
http://dinncoparalegal.bkqw.cn
http://dinncoantipathy.bkqw.cn
http://dinncocounterreformation.bkqw.cn
http://dinncoxiphoid.bkqw.cn
http://dinncotensile.bkqw.cn
http://dinncominorite.bkqw.cn
http://dinncocobaltiferous.bkqw.cn
http://dinncohibernaculum.bkqw.cn
http://dinncoendosteum.bkqw.cn
http://dinncotelegenic.bkqw.cn
http://dinncoquadrennium.bkqw.cn
http://dinncomonticulate.bkqw.cn
http://dinncohemochromatosis.bkqw.cn
http://dinncoparathyroid.bkqw.cn
http://dinncoaglimmer.bkqw.cn
http://dinncopostage.bkqw.cn
http://dinncobunny.bkqw.cn
http://dinncotestudo.bkqw.cn
http://dinncoblessing.bkqw.cn
http://dinncokhadi.bkqw.cn
http://dinncoshamvaian.bkqw.cn
http://dinncokeckle.bkqw.cn
http://dinncounlikelihood.bkqw.cn
http://dinncoaffably.bkqw.cn
http://dinncorhabdovirus.bkqw.cn
http://dinncobioclean.bkqw.cn
http://www.dinnco.com/news/137323.html

相关文章:

  • 网站无搜索结果页面怎么做网站之家查询
  • 网站维护由供应商做么班级优化大师免费下载
  • 做企业英语网站要注意哪些友情链接网站源码
  • 做网站分页成人大学报名官网入口
  • 外贸网站虚拟空间qq代刷网站推广免费
  • 合肥网站专业制作网络营销工具介绍
  • 公众号文章制作模板宁波网站seo诊断工具
  • 北京 建设官方网站太原搜索引擎优化招聘信息
  • 广东网站建设电话友情链接
  • 外贸网站做多少钱的淘宝网络营销方式
  • 旅游网站推广方案成品视频直播软件推荐哪个好一点
  • 永久网站山西seo优化
  • 做系统去哪网站下载镜像jsurl转码
  • 免费网站开发框架热点新闻最新消息
  • 站长工具站长之家官网市场营销计划
  • 服饰网站建设哈尔滨最新
  • 网站备案密码修改常州网站推广公司
  • 昆明定制网站建设百度大搜数据多少钱一条
  • 课程商城网站模板产品推广计划怎么写
  • 企业网站策划案怎么写优化大师官网
  • 常见的网站首页布局最新新闻事件今天国内大事
  • 什么网站ghost做的好一键生成原创文案
  • 手机网站模板源码设计素材网站
  • 百度做网站靠什么收费营销
  • 崇信县门户网站留言首页青岛seo关键字排名
  • 社区网站搭建百度站长工具查询
  • 中文域名 怎么做网站能打开各种网站的浏览器
  • wordpress 食谱网站长春网站建设 4435
  • 公司网站一年多少钱 百度一下
  • asp网站js悬浮窗怎么做做个公司网站一般需要多少钱